Arnold Clark, the UK's largest family-owned motor retailer, has begun sponsorship of ITV's BAFTA and NTA-winning TV show This Morning.

Its broadcast idents, which bookend each advertising break, have been created in-house by the Arnold Clark filming team and present real-life moments featuring the family car.

The scenarios are relatable and pay homage to This Morning’s signature presenting style.

These will be supported by additional digital and social content to help integrate the viewing experience with Arnold Clark’s online presence.

The multi-year deal, beginning on September 1, spans every consumer touchpoint, including broadcast, digital and app, social media and content, and experiential and licensing.

Over the years Arnold Clark has steadily spread its brand reach from its Scotland heartland further and further south through England, opening franchised dealerships and Motorstore used car supermarkets through the Midlands and introducing click and collect depots in Milton Keynes and Southampton.

Russell Borrie, Sales Director at Arnold Clark said: ‘Arnold Clark began in 1954 with just a single showroom. Over the decades, we’ve grown with more than 200 branches stretching from Elgin in the North to Southampton in the South, hugely increasing the services we offer. This is Arnold Clark’s second high-profile television partnership of 2021, following their sponsorship of Channel 4 Drama and Walter Presents content which began in January. In addition, it has a longstanding partnership with the talkSPORT Breakfast Show.
